The Gomez’s deck is shown below. The deck is a regular hexagon. It has a perimeter of 45 units. What is the are of the deck

Answer:

The area of the deck is of 146.14 squared units.

Explanation:

Regular hexagon:

A regular hexagon has 6 sides, all with the same measure.

Perimeter of a regular hexagon:

The perimeter of a regular hexagon with side x is given by:


P_h = 6x

Area of a regular hexagon:

The area of a regular hexagon with side x is given by:


A_h = (3√(3)x^(2))/(2)

It has a perimeter of 45 units.

This means that:


6x = 45


x = (45)/(6)


x = 7.5

What is the are of the deck


A_h = (3√(3)x^(2))/(2) = (3√(3)*(7.5)^(2))/(2) = 146.14

The area of the deck is of 146.14 squared units.
